The Apprentice Perspective
Apprenticeships are on the rise in Illinois. These programs offer businesses a way to build the high-skill talent they need. These programs also offer Illinoisans a path to a long-term, family-sustaining career in fields driven by market demand without the need for a four-year degree.
The Apprentice Ambassador Program seeks out a yearly cohort of star current or former apprentices to represent a wide variety of industries and locations within Illinois. During their year in the cohort, Apprentice Ambassadors are featured as guest speakers at business events to highlight the impact apprenticeships have had on them, their families, and their companies. This podcast brings our Ambassadors’ stories to you, our listeners. Every episode also features a guest host who is a leader in business, government, or workforce development.
